About UPMC St. Margaret and UPMC

  • UPMC St. Margaret s a 249-bed acute care and teaching hospital near Aspinwall, PA, serving the residents of northeastern Allegheny County and the Alle-Kiski Valley.
  • The site is a Magnet®-designated hospital — the highest international recognition for nursing excellence and leadership. Key specialties include orthopedic services, family medicine, general surgery, critical care, bariatric surgery, and emergency medicine.
